Alexander Alexandrovich Orlov (Kirill) was born on June 5, 1837 in Karinskoe, Zvenigorod district, Moscow Oblast', Russian Federation.
Alexander Alexandrovich graduated from the Vifan Theological Seminary (1858) and the Moscow Theological Academy (1862).
In 1862, Alexander Alexandrovich became a monk. He was a keeper of the Zvenigorod Theological School (1862-1863). He was an inspector of the Vifan Theological Seminary (1863-1880), at the same time was an abbot of the Moscow Znamensky Monastery (1872-1880). Alexander Alexandrovich was the Bishop of Ostrogozhsky, the Vicar of the Voronezh Diocese (1880-1882), at the same time abbot of the Alekseyevskiy Akatov Monastery. He was a bishop of Cheboksary, Vicar of the Kazan Diocese (1882-1888), where he led an active struggle against schism. Bishop of Kovno, Vicar of the Vilna Diocese (since 1889), at the same time the Head of the Vilna Svyatoduhovsky Brotherhood and the Diocesan School Council.
